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
  • 6 slices bacon, cooked and crumbled
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ar or Colby Jack cheese
  • ⅓ cup ranch dressing (plus more for drizzling)
  • 10–12 small flour tortillas (street-size)
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• ½ teaspoon onion powder
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• Olive oil spray or melted butter (for brushing)
  • 1 cup shredded iceberg or romaine lettuce

Ingredient Substitutions and Notes

If you’re looking to customize your tacos, there are plenty of substitutions you can use. For the cheese, feel free to swap mozzarella and cheddar with pepper jack or a dairy-free alternative for those with dietary restrictions.

If you’re short on ranch dressing, consider mixing sour cream with a bit of garlic powder and some herbs to create a quick alternative. If you prefer soft tortillas, corn tortillas can also work but might need extra care when folding to prevent tearing. Don’t hesitate to throw in any extra vegetables you have on hand, such as bell peppers or onions, to bulk up your filling without relying solely on meat.

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ions

Preheat oven to 400°F. Lightly grease a baking dish or sheet pan. In a large bowl, combine shredded chicken, bacon, mozzarella, cheddar, ranch dressing, garlic powder, onion powder, and black pepper. Warm tortillas slightly so they’re pliable. Spoon chicken mixture evenly into each tortilla and fold. Arrange tacos seam-side down in the prepared baking dish. Lightly brush or spray tops with olive oil or melted butter. Bake uncovered for 15–18 minutes, or until tortillas are crisp and cheese is melted. Remove from oven and top with shredded lettuce and a drizzle of ranch dressing. Serve immediately.

Tips for Perfectly Cooked Tacos

For the crispiest tacos, be sure to allow sufficient space between each taco on your baking sheet. If they are packed too closely together, they may steam instead of crisp, leading to a soggy texture. Keep a close eye on them during the last couple of minutes in the oven, as ovens can vary significantly in temperature.

A good test for doneness is to check for a golden-brown color on the tortilla edges, while the cheese should be fully melted and bubbling. If you like your tacos extra crispy, consider broiling them for the last minute of cooking, but watch them closely to prevent burning.

Storage and Reheating Guidance

Leftover tacos can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. If you want to enjoy that crispy texture after storing, consider reheating them in a toaster oven rather than the microwave. Preheat your toaster oven to 350°F and place the tacos on a baking sheet for about 10 minutes or until warmed through.

Alternatively, if you prefer a microwave, use a microwave-safe plate and cover them with a damp paper towel to prevent them from drying out. They won’t be as crispy, but they’ll still be delicious!

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a different dressing instead of ranch?

Absolutely! While ranch is a classic option, any creamy dressing such as blue cheese or even a spicy chipotle dressing can work just as well, depending on your flavor preference.

Can I prepare these tacos 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are everything up to the baking step while keeping the assembled tacos in the fridge for a few hours. Just be prepared to increase the baking time slightly if they go into the oven cold.

How can I spice these tacos up?

For an extra kick, you can add diced jalapeños to the chicken mixture or sprinkle some cayenne pepper into the blend. Additionally, serving with hot sauce or a spicy salsa can satisfy those who crave heat.
